1 Sponsorship on Standardisation
Barteld Braaksma (Statistics Netherlands) Wim Kloek (Eurostat)

2 Brief history Mandate approved in May 2011 by ESSC
Members: 6 NSIs (DE, FR, IT, LV, HU, NL) and Eurostat Duration two years Regular reporting to ESSC and PG Interaction with DIME and ITDG Communication to other international groups (e.g. HLG-BAS) Kick-Off meeting September 2011, Brussels Second meeting November 2011, Luxemburg (short) Third meeting January 2012, Budapest Fourth meeting July 2012, Riga 2

3 Kick-Off meeting (22+23 September, Brussels)
Focus on review of standardisation experiences (‘We are not alone’) Statistical community (DE, HU) Eurocontrol (Single Sky) Cap Gemini (EU Digital Agenda) Report of ESSnet Preparation of Standardisation First exchange of views on Programme of Work 2012 3

4 Kick-Off meeting (22+23 September, Brussels)
Lessons learned Standardisation takes at least 10 to 20 years Implementation phase involves large budgets Concrete pilots needed as guides and test cases Governance and maintenance of standards important Good standards promote themselves Both quality and efficiency are drivers ISO/IEC vocabulary can be (re)used Other observations Business case for standardisation not yet sufficiently clear Concerns about resources 4

5 PoW 2012: Three pillars of activity
Stocktaking of current standards (HU leading) Annotated and structured list of standards Assessment of their status, quality and maturity Identification of gaps Framework for standardisation (IT leading) Why? What/who? How? ESS High-level architecture Road map for standardisation (time frame, ambition level) Pilot studies, for example (?? leading) Infrastructure: EuroGroups Register (EGR), Census Hub or SDMX Cross country sharing of tools Data validation process Output harmonisation/consistent use of classifications and concepts
